[–]ARandomSliceOfCheese 0 points1 point  (0 children)

Looks like the bulb sequence after a reset. Try resetting the bulb by switching it off first. Then doing an on off cycle 5x. It should flash this color sequence then stay white and need resetup unfortunately

How to deal with shrinking wrap under oven by ARandomSliceOfCheese in cabinetry

[–]ARandomSliceOfCheese[S] 0 points1 point  (0 children)

Just in case someone else finds this with the same problem: I ended up using the high heat epoxy. Just make sure you don’t overfill and keep a paper towel handy for wiping excess. Tested with a couple of oven sessions and it seems to be holding up just fine. There are some spots I under filled that I’ll patch but good enough until I can replace it or repaint all the cabinets
